Title: The Innovations of Slawomir Banasiak

Introduction

Slawomir Banasiak is a notable inventor based in Kearny, NJ, who has made significant contributions to the field of dental prosthetics. With a total of six patents to his name, his work focuses on enhancing the aesthetic and functional qualities of dental materials.

Latest Patents

One of Banasiak's latest inventions is a shade-coordinated, veneering porcelain system for dental prostheses. This invention features a shaded porcelain system that includes two types of veneering porcelains: a natural enamel/dentin body and opal enamel. It also incorporates stain and glaze porcelain with compatible coefficients of thermal expansion (CTE), which can be used for veneering dental prostheses made from either lithium disilicate-based glass-ceramic or YTZP zirconia-based ceramic substructures. This innovation aims to improve the overall aesthetics of the final dental prosthesis. Another significant patent is for translucent veneering for a dental prosthesis formed by a press-to-metal process. This dental prosthesis includes a porcelain composition that provides a tooth-like translucency, enhancing its aesthetic appearance. The composition consists of a dentin frit and an enamel frit, which are typically sintered into a desired ingot shape, allowing for effective veneering of the prosthesis.

Career Highlights

Throughout his career, Banasiak has worked with prominent companies in the dental industry, including Dentsply International Inc. and Dentsply Sirona Inc. His experience in these organizations has allowed him to develop and refine his innovative ideas in dental technology.

Collaborations

Banasiak has collaborated with notable professionals in his field, including Christopher Chu and Vicky Nemzer. These collaborations have contributed to the advancement of dental prosthetic technologies.
